The Battlefield Website has further follow-up on news that illicit ranked
servers were running to allow players to pad their stats ( story).
Word is over 700 accounts have been reset as a result of cheating: It is
always our commitment to work to prevent cheating and stat padding as part of an
ongoing process. After the problems brought to light recently we have been
working with the Ranked Server Providers to bring the stat padding to an end as
well as dealing with those who have been using the exploit to boost their
scores. Since the problem was detected, we have reset over 700 accounts of
players found to be padding and will continue to do so whilst we secure the
ranking system from future attacks. Please report any servers or players you
suspect of cheating and/or padding to EA Customer Support through the website at
http://support.ea.com.
Shacknews has a
correction to reports they posted earlier that the US edition of Age of Conan
will be censored in North America, saying they've learned from Funcom that the
NA edition of the MMORPG will not be censored, and will be rated "Mature" by the
ESRB. The earlier reports stated that the game would contain nipples that would
not be shown in the US edition, but the subsequent clarification of the game's
"M" rating says it will not contain any nudity. The original report also
correctly stated the German edition of the game will have some of its violence
cut.

Planet
Battlefield has more new details on Battlefield Heroes as skinny (some of it just semi-accurate) about the free-to-play installment in DICE's shooter series continues to
slowly drip out. They have a bunch of bullet points based on an article in the
latest issue of Games For Windows magazine that outline the abilities of
a few classes (Soldier, Commando, and Gunner), how scoring will work, a bit on
in-game items, and gameplay factors like shorter spawn times, how vehicles spawn
when you arrive at proper location, how firefights will be longer, and the
game's support for "lone
wolf" gameplay. There's also a bit that sheds more confusion on the question of
whether this will be a third-person game ( story) or not
( story), as it says the "entire game is 3rd person," but then
qualifies that, suggesting like Vizzini in The Princess Bride, the word "entire"
doesn't mean what someone thinks it means: "Entire game is 3rd person so you can see
the customizations your player has. Also allows you to see your player blown
into the air. If 1st person is really wanted it can be changed over time."

The
NVIDIA AGEIA PhysX Acquisition Q&A on FiringSquad talks with NVIDIA's Derek
Perez about the acquisition of AGEIA, a fellow all-caps hardware company. He
uses the same "heterogeneous computing model" phrase used yesterday to announce
the move ( story), an interesting take, since it sounds like they
plan to homogenize AGEIA's PPU onto their GPUs, saying "Physics is a natural for
processing on the GPU." As for existing stand-alone PhysX cards, he says: "We
will continue to support the current line of Ageia products that are on the
market today."

IGN reports that the soccer/football series known as Winning Eleven Soccer
in the United States will now be known as Pro Evolution Soccer 2008, the same
title the sports game carries in the rest of the world. They wistfully point out
that this means an end to the dream that the next installment in the series would be known
as Winning Eleven Soccer 11.
